Transaction 8434dbfd13a7afbc84249870fcd3aa8f0c6ca10b3cd8376d7ae0ad7fd0510aee
1 Input
1 Output
-
8434dbfd13a7afbc84249870fcd3aa8f0c6ca10b3cd8376d7ae0ad7fd0510aee:0
- value
- 337430
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 677e01d560fb517e9044684c75cc7bc892e63e45 OP_EQUAL
- address
- 3B8EUS6DRY3DBBhSMQ52FTnvMWEMUjaUHy